Supporting Your Back and Arms: Ergonomic Considerations

Supporting Your Back and Arms: Ergonomic Considerations

The Importance of Ergonomic Support During Breastfeeding

Did you know that nearly 70% of new mothers experience discomfort in their back and arms during breastfeeding? This can be significantly influenced by the chair they choose for nursing. When selecting a comfortable chair for breastfeeding,it’s essential to consider ergonomic features that support proper posture,reduce strain,and enhance the overall breastfeeding experience.

Key Factors for Back and Arm Support:

To create a supportive environment for breastfeeding,look for chairs that prioritize these ergonomic considerations:

  • Adjustable Seat height: The seat should be at a height that allows your feet to rest flat on the ground,promoting better stability and reducing lower back strain.
  • Proper Lumbar Support: Look for chairs with built-in lumbar support or adjustable cushions that conform to the natural curve of your spine.
  • Wide Armrests: Armrests should be adequately padded and positioned to allow your arms to rest comfortably without elevating your shoulders, which can lead to tension and fatigue.
  • Rocking or Gliding Motion: Choose chairs that offer a rocking or gliding feature, which can help soothe both you and your baby while encouraging a gentle flow of milk.

fabric and Cushioning: What’s Best for Long Nursing Sessions?

Did you know that the right combination of fabric and cushioning can dramatically enhance your breastfeeding experience? When it comes to long nursing sessions, comfort should be your number one priority.The perfect chair not only supports you physically but also creates a soothing ambiance for both you and your little one. Here’s what you need to consider when choosing the ideal materials for your cozy breastfeeding haven.

Fabric Choices: Softness Meets Breathability

When selecting a comfortable chair for breastfeeding,the fabric plays a crucial role in your overall comfort. Here are some popular options, each with its unique benefits:

  • Cotton: Known for its breathability and softness, cotton is a top choice for nursing chairs. It’s easy to maintain and hypoallergenic, making it suitable for both mom and baby.
  • Microfiber: This synthetic material boasts a soft touch and is often stain-resistant, which is a practical advantage during spills and accidents.
  • Upholstered Fabrics: Textured options like linen or velvet can add a bit of luxury to your nursing space. however, they may require more upkeep compared to cotton.

Consider fabrics that won’t irritate your skin or hold onto odors, since nursing can sometiems lead to spills. Look for materials that offer some stretch, providing both comfort and ease of movement as you shift positions.

Cushioning: The Key to Extended Comfort

Equally critically important as the fabric is the type of cushioning used in your chair. you’ll be spending quite a bit of time in that seat, so ensure it offers sufficient support. Here are some cushioning options that cater to long nursing sessions:

  • High-Density Foam: This type of foam retains its shape over time and provides excellent support for your back and arms.
  • Memory Foam: Ideal for those who appreciate a cradling sensation, memory foam molds to your body, offering relief from pressure points.
  • Gel-Infused Foam: Combine the benefits of memory foam with cooling properties to avoid overheating during extended nursing sessions.
